How To Install libmongodb-java on Debian 9
Introduction
In this tutorial we learn how to install libmongodb-java
on Debian 9.
What is libmongodb-java
libmongodb-java is:
Java library to connect to the MongoDB document database.
There are three methods to install libmongodb-java
on Debian 9. We can use apt-get
, apt
and aptitude
.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.
Install libmongodb-java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install libmongodb-java
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install libmongodb-java
Install libmongodb-java Using apt
Update apt database with apt
using the following command.
sudo apt update
After updating apt database, We can install libmongodb-java
using apt
by running the following command:
sudo apt -y install libmongodb-java

How To Uninstall libmongodb-java on Debian 9
To uninstall only the libmongodb-java
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ove libmongodb-java
Uninstall libmongodb-java And Its Dependencies
To uninstall libmongodb-java
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 9,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ove libmongodb-java
Remove libmongodb-java Configurations and Data
To remove libmongodb-java
configuration and data from Debian 9 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ge libmongodb-java
Remove libmongodb-java config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ove libmongodb-java
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ge libmongodb-java
